What is the APC 1000VA Backup (BV1000I-MS)?

The APC BV1000I-MS is part of the APC Easy UPS BV series, engineered to provide power protection during unstable power conditions. With a capacity of 1000VA (volt-amperes) or 600 watts, this UPS ensures that your essential electronics stay powered during outages and are protected from voltage fluctuations and surges. It’s a floor or wall-mountable unit featuring four universal outlets, all equipped with battery backup and surge protection, making it versatile for various devices.

This UPS operates on a line-interactive topology, meaning it can regulate voltage without switching to battery power in many cases, preserving battery life for when it’s truly needed. Key Features of the BV1000I-MS

  1. Power Capacity: Rated at 1000VA/600W, this UPS can handle a moderate load—think a PC, monitor, and router—keeping them operational during brief outages or giving you enough time to save your work and shut down safely.
  2. Automatic Voltage Regulation (AVR): The built-in AVR corrects low and high voltages automatically, ensuring your devices receive stable power without draining the battery unnecessarily.
  3. Universal Outlets: With four widely spaced universal receptacles, the BV1000I-MS accommodates bulky plugs and works with a variety of international plug types, adding to its flexibility.
  4. Surge Protection: Offering a surge energy rating of 156 Joules, it shields your equipment from damaging power spikes caused by lightning or electrical faults.
  5. Battery Backup: The sealed lead-acid battery kicks in instantly during an outage, providing runtime that varies based on the connected load—typically a few minutes at full capacity, longer with lighter loads.
  6. LED Indicators and Audible Alarms: Simple LED status lights show whether the unit is on mains power or battery, while alarms alert you to low battery or overload conditions.
  7. Compact Design: Its sleek, lightweight build allows for easy placement on a desk, floor, or even mounted on a wall, fitting seamlessly into tight spaces.

Performance Insights

The BV1000I-MS uses a stepped approximation to a sine wave output, which is sufficient for most consumer electronics like PCs and routers. However, for highly sensitive equipment requiring a pure sine wave (e.g., certain medical devices or high-end servers), you might need to consider a different model. Its transfer time of 6-10 milliseconds ensures a quick switch to battery power, minimizing disruption.

Battery life typically ranges from 3-5 years, depending on usage and environmental conditions, with an 8-hour recharge time after depletion. Runtime varies: at a 600W full load, expect a few minutes, while a lighter 120W load could stretch it to 15-20 minutes.

Installation and Maintenance Tips

Setting up the BV1000I-MS is straightforward—plug it into a wall outlet, connect your devices, and let it charge for 8 hours before first use. For maintenance:

  • Periodically check the battery status via the LED indicators.
  • Keep the unit in a well-ventilated area to avoid overheating.
  • Replace the battery every 3-5 years or if the UPS signals a fault.
